// Code generated by software.amazon.smithy.rust.codegen.smithy-rs. DO NOT EDIT.

/// <p>A notification that's associated with a budget. A budget can have up to ten notifications.</p>
/// <p>Each notification must have at least one subscriber. A notification can have one SNS subscriber and up to 10 email subscribers, for a total of 11 subscribers.</p>
/// <p>For example, if you have a budget for 200 dollars and you want to be notified when you go over 160 dollars, create a notification with the following parameters:</p>
/// <ul>
/// <li>
/// <p>A notificationType of <code>ACTUAL</code></p></li>
/// <li>
/// <p>A <code>thresholdType</code> of <code>PERCENTAGE</code></p></li>
/// <li>
/// <p>A <code>comparisonOperator</code> of <code>GREATER_THAN</code></p></li>
/// <li>
/// <p>A notification <code>threshold</code> of <code>80</code></p></li>
/// </ul>
#[non_exhaustive]
#[derive(::std::clone::Clone, ::std::cmp::PartialEq, ::std::fmt::Debug)]
pub struct Notification {
    /// <p>Specifies whether the notification is for how much you have spent (<code>ACTUAL</code>) or for how much that you're forecasted to spend (<code>FORECASTED</code>).</p>
    pub notification_type: crate::types::NotificationType,
    /// <p>The comparison that's used for this notification.</p>
    pub comparison_operator: crate::types::ComparisonOperator,
    /// <p>The threshold that's associated with a notification. Thresholds are always a percentage, and many customers find value being alerted between 50% - 200% of the budgeted amount. The maximum limit for your threshold is 1,000,000% above the budgeted amount.</p>
    pub threshold: f64,
    /// <p>The type of threshold for a notification. For <code>ABSOLUTE_VALUE</code> thresholds, Amazon Web Services notifies you when you go over or are forecasted to go over your total cost threshold. For <code>PERCENTAGE</code> thresholds, Amazon Web Services notifies you when you go over or are forecasted to go over a certain percentage of your forecasted spend. For example, if you have a budget for 200 dollars and you have a <code>PERCENTAGE</code> threshold of 80%, Amazon Web Services notifies you when you go over 160 dollars.</p>
    pub threshold_type: ::std::option::Option<crate::types::ThresholdType>,
    /// <p>Specifies whether this notification is in alarm. If a budget notification is in the <code>ALARM</code> state, you passed the set threshold for the budget.</p>
    pub notification_state: ::std::option::Option<crate::types::NotificationState>,
}
impl Notification {
    /// <p>Specifies whether the notification is for how much you have spent (<code>ACTUAL</code>) or for how much that you're forecasted to spend (<code>FORECASTED</code>).</p>
    pub fn notification_type(&self) -> &crate::types::NotificationType {
        &self.notification_type
    }
    /// <p>The comparison that's used for this notification.</p>
    pub fn comparison_operator(&self) -> &crate::types::ComparisonOperator {
        &self.comparison_operator
    }
    /// <p>The threshold that's associated with a notification. Thresholds are always a percentage, and many customers find value being alerted between 50% - 200% of the budgeted amount. The maximum limit for your threshold is 1,000,000% above the budgeted amount.</p>
    pub fn threshold(&self) -> f64 {
        self.threshold
    }
    /// <p>The type of threshold for a notification. For <code>ABSOLUTE_VALUE</code> thresholds, Amazon Web Services notifies you when you go over or are forecasted to go over your total cost threshold. For <code>PERCENTAGE</code> thresholds, Amazon Web Services notifies you when you go over or are forecasted to go over a certain percentage of your forecasted spend. For example, if you have a budget for 200 dollars and you have a <code>PERCENTAGE</code> threshold of 80%, Amazon Web Services notifies you when you go over 160 dollars.</p>
    pub fn threshold_type(&self) -> ::std::option::Option<&crate::types::ThresholdType> {
        self.threshold_type.as_ref()
    }
    /// <p>Specifies whether this notification is in alarm. If a budget notification is in the <code>ALARM</code> state, you passed the set threshold for the budget.</p>
    pub fn notification_state(&self) -> ::std::option::Option<&crate::types::NotificationState> {
        self.notification_state.as_ref()
    }
}
